ü  Read the following passage carefully.(8 Marks)
                The pole vault is truly the glamour event of any track and field competition. The sportsman combines the grace of a gymnast with the strength of a bodybuilder. Pole-vaulting also has the element of flying, and the thought of flying as high as a two-storeyed building is a mere fantasy to anyone watching such an event. Today it is not only Michael Stone’s reality and dream – it is his quest.
ü  Now choose the appropriate choice for the following questions.
1.       The game mentioned in the passage is …….. (           )


a.       Cricket
b.      Hockey
c.       Kabaddi
d.      Pole-vaulting


2.       The Pole-vaulting has two elements. They are …. (           )


a.       Running and  Swimming
b.      Running and Jumping
c.       Gymnast and Flying
d.      Gymnast and Dreaming


3.       What was Michael’s dram? (      )


a.       To become a running champion
b.      To become a pole-vault champion
c.       To become a gymnast champion
d.      To become a dreamer champion


4.       Find out the true statement(s). (         )


a.       Michael Stone isn’t a blind person.
b.      Michael’s mother read a numerous stories to him.
c.       Michael’s father wasn’t a hard core realist.
d.      All are correct.

A self-test on vocabulary and grammar for class X English



A self-test on vocabulary and grammar for class X English

Name of the student: ……………………………….

Read the paragraph carefully and fill in the blanks with appropriate option given under.

The Indian film industry ……….. (1) completed a hundred years ………. (2) the year 2013. It is a fitting tribute to the world ……….. (3) cinema to recollect our favourite films, producers, directors, actors, and music and art directors.
Telugu audiences are proud ……….. (4) many great producers, directors and artistes. Savitri is one such prestigious artiste. Ever since she ………. (5) eight, she evinced interest in learning dance. Later she associated herself ……….. (6) the theatre. She formed a theatre organization as well. She had ………… (7) difficulty in …………… (8) the film field. When Savitri was twelve, she was ……… (9) a role in the film, Agnipareeksha, ………. (10) was finally dropped as she looked too young for the role.
1.       A) was                                 B) were                            C) are                                   D) be
2.       A) on                                   B) in                                 C) after                                D) about
3.       A) in                                    B) on                                 C) of                                    D) to
4.       A) in                                    B) on                                 C) of                                    D) to
5.       A) was                                 B) were                              C) are                                  D) be
6.       A) by                                   B) with                               C) among                            D) on
7.       A) few                                 B) some                              C) little                               D) x
8.       A) enters                           B) entered                             C) enter                               D) entering
9.       A) offers                            B) offered                           C) offer                                 D) offering
10.   A) and                                B) yet                                  C) but                                   D) did
